1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/riscv-mcu-riscv-glibc

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
Внести вклад в разработку кода
Синхронизировать код
Отмена
Подсказка: Поскольку Git не поддерживает пустые директории, создание директории приведёт к созданию пустого файла .keep.
Loading...
README
В этой директории находятся исходные коды библиотеки GNU C.

Чтобы узнать, какая у вас версия, смотрите файл «version.h».

Библиотека GNU C — это стандартная системная библиотека C для всех систем GNU и важная часть того, что составляет систему GNU. Она предоставляет системный API для всех программ, написанных на C и C-совместимых языках, таких как C++ и Objective C; средства выполнения других языков программирования используют библиотеку C для доступа к базовой операционной системе.

В системах GNU/Linux библиотека C работает с ядром Linux для реализации поведения операционной системы, видимого пользовательскими приложениями. В системах GNU/Hurd она работает с микроядром и серверами Hurd.

Библиотека GNU C реализует большую часть функциональности POSIX.1 в системе GNU/Hurd, используя конфигурации i[4567]86-*-gnu.

При работе с ядрами Linux эта версия библиотеки GNU C требует версии ядра Linux 3.2 или более поздней.

Также обратите внимание, что для правильной работы библиотеки pthread должна быть установлена общая версия библиотеки libgcc_s.

Библиотека GNU C поддерживает следующие конфигурации для использования ядер Linux:
* aarch64*-*-linux-gnu;
* alpha*-*-linux-gnu;
* arc*-*-linux-gnu;
* arm-*-linux-gnueabi;
* csky-*-linux-gnuabiv2;
* hppa-*-linux-gnu;
* i[4567]86-*-linux-gnu (можно собрать x86_64 или x32);
* ia64-*-linux-gnu;
* m68k-*-linux-gnu;
* microblaze*-*-linux-gnu;
* mips-*-linux-gnu;
* mips64-*-linux-gnu;
* or1k-*-linux-gnu;
* powerpc-*-linux-gnu (аппаратная или программная плавающая точка, только BE);
* powerpc64*-*-linux-gnu (большой и малый порядок байтов);
* s390-*-linux-gnu;
* s390x-*-linux-gnu;
* riscv32-*-linux-gnu;
* riscv64-*-linux-gnu;
* sh[34]-*-linux-gnu;
* sparc*-*-linux-gnu;
* sparc64*-*-linux-gnu.

Если вы заинтересованы в портировании, пожалуйста, свяжитесь с сопровождающими glibc; дополнительную информацию см. на сайте https://www.gnu.org/software/libc/.

Информацию о том, как настроить, собрать и установить библиотеку GNU C, можно найти в файле INSTALL. Вы также можете ознакомиться с веб-страницами библиотеки C по адресу https://www.gnu.org/software/libc/.

Почти вся документация библиотеки GNU C представлена в руководстве Texinfo, которое находится в подкаталоге `manual/`. Руководство всё ещё обновляется и содержит некоторые известные ошибки и пропуски; мы сожалеем, что у нас нет ресурсов, чтобы работать над руководством так, как нам хотелось бы. Для исправления руководства, пожалуйста, создайте баг в компоненте `manual`, следуя приведённым ниже инструкциям по созданию отчётов об ошибках. Обязательно проверьте руководство в текущих источниках разработки, чтобы узнать, была ли ваша проблема уже исправлена.

Пожалуйста, посетите страницу https://www.gnu.org/software/libc/bugs.html для получения информации о создании отчётов об ошибках. Сейчас мы используем систему Bugzilla для отслеживания всех отчётов об ошибках. На этой веб-странице представлена подробная информация о том, как правильно сообщать об ошибках.

GNU C Library — это свободное программное обеспечение. См. файл COPYING.LIB для условий копирования и LICENSES для уведомлений о нескольких вкладах, которые требуют распространения этих дополнительных уведомлений. Годы авторских прав могут быть указаны с использованием нотации диапазона, например, 1996–2015, что означает, что каждый год в диапазоне, включительно, является годом авторского права, который иначе был бы указан отдельно.

Комментарии ( 0 )

Вы можете оставить комментарий после Вход в систему

Введение

Описание недоступно Развернуть Свернуть
GPL-2.0
Отмена

Обновления

Пока нет обновлений

Участники

все

Недавние действия

Загрузить больше
Больше нет результатов для загрузки
1
https://api.gitlife.ru/oschina-mirror/riscv-mcu-riscv-glibc.git
git@api.gitlife.ru:oschina-mirror/riscv-mcu-riscv-glibc.git
oschina-mirror
riscv-mcu-riscv-glibc
riscv-mcu-riscv-glibc
master